Departmental and Branch Accounts are essential topics in Financial Accounting that focus on the accounting treatment of multiple business units within a single organization. Understanding the concept of departmental and branch accounts is crucial for effectively analyzing and managing the financial performance of each segment.
Concept of Departmental and Branch Accounts: Departmental accounts are used by businesses with various departments to track individual performance, revenue, and expenses. On the other hand, branch accounts are employed when a business operates multiple units in different locations, which are treated as separate entities for accounting purposes.
Differences between a Department and a Branch: The key dissimilarity between a department and a branch lies in their legal status and autonomy. Departments are typically under the direct control of the central management, while branches often have more independence in decision-making and operations.
Preparation of Departmental Accounts: To prepare departmental accounts, revenue and expenses are allocated to specific departments, enabling the management to evaluate the performance of each unit accurately. The process involves segregating costs and revenues attributable to each department for analysis.
Preparation of Branch Accounts Excluding Foreign Branches: Branch accounts are prepared to assess the financial performance of individual branches within a company. These accounts include branch-specific income, expenses, assets, and liabilities, allowing for a detailed evaluation of each branch's contribution to the overall business.
Inter-branch Transactions: Inter-branch transactions refer to financial activities that occur between different branches of the same organization. It is crucial to properly account for these transactions to prevent discrepancies in financial records and ensure accurate reporting of the overall financial position of the company.
